
The Jeremy Brett Sherlock Holmes Podcast
A podcast dedicated to revisiting and honoring Jeremy Brett's portrayal of Sherlock Holmes in the Granada Television series from 1984 to 1994. The show examines the 36 episodes and 5 movies, focusing on Brett's iconic performance. It explores the production and legacy of this acclaimed adaptation.

June Wyndham Davies: A Sherlockian Conversation
In this very special episode, we are thrilled to present our conversation with series producer and show-runner June Wyndham Davies. At the request of Granada chairman David Plowright, June began producing the show in 1986 ("The Return") and shepherded an incredible 22 stories from page to screen. David Burke: A Sherlockian Conversation
In this very special episode, we are honored to present our conversation with actor David Burke. Burke portrayed Dr. John Watson in the first thirteen episodes of the Granada series and (together with Jeremy Brett and Michael Cox) helped to reinvent the character for a new generation.
